
A once-in-a-generation transformation of South Valley’s grounds
We’ve made huge progress in 2025:
- Brand-new parking lot
- Improved, closer ADA parking
- New sidewalks for safe access
- Grounds and landscaping are nearly complete
These changes already make South Valley more welcoming, more accessible, and more beautiful for everyone who arrives on our campus.

Budget Summary
| Project Component | Cost |
|---|---|
| Excavation, Grading, Roadbase, Asphalt | $89,187 |
| Water Line / Meter Move | $10,950 |
| Lot Cleaning & Painting | $2,370 |
| Curbs, Sidewalks, Concrete Work | $31,589 |
| Urban Forest: Trees, Plants, Path | $67,000 |
| Soil, Mulch, Plants, Irrigation | $96,816 |
| Engineering & Survey | $12,000 |
| City Fees, Permits, Light Pole Removal | $5,360 |
| Signs, Railings, Large Planter Pots | $9,900 |
| TOTAL INVESTMENT | $326,098 |
